Situated in a highly sought after, rural, private close of just 16 properties. This spacious two bedroomed detached bungalow with level gardens, good sized singe garage and parking. Access to approximately two acres of communal grounds.

The property is located within the village of Walford just three miles south of the market town of Ross-on-Wye. Green Colley Grove is a unique rural close of just 16 varied properties, each with their own gardens and grounds, together with a share of two acres of communal grounds which envelope the properties giving privacy and a wonderful outlook. Within the village there is an excellent primary school, church and village hall. The Mill Race Public House/ Restaurant is just a short stroll away. There are miles of country and riverside walks on the door step.

The market town of Ross on Wye is approximately three miles away which offers a good range of shopping, social and sporting facilities. There are also excellent road links to the Midlands via the M50/M5 and South Wales via the A40/M4. Monmouth lies approximately 6 miles to the South.

General Information:
There are 16 properties on this small development, each property having an equal share in the communal private land which extends to around two acres and is a purely for the enjoyment of the residents of the estate. A limited Management Company has been set up for management of communal areas, roadways and sewage treatment plant and to create a sinking fund for future maintenance. Charges being set currently at approximately £870 per annum. Each property holds an equal share of the management company. Further information can be gained for the agent.
